Title:
SCREEN STENCIL FOR TEXITILE PRINTING
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JPS61291190
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

PURPOSE: To provide a screen stencil for textile printing by directly drawing a pattern while melting a film, a paper or the like formed of a synthetic or semi-synthetic highmolecular weight material without affecting a plain gauze by radiations such as laser beams or ultrasonic waves.

CONSTITUTION: A film, tanned paper or thin sheet formed of a synthetic or semi-synthetic high molecular weight material 3 capable of being melted at a temperature not higher than the heat-resisting temperature of ceramic fibers is jointed to a screen comprising a plain gauze 1 fitted to a frame 2, thereby producing a screen 4. While irradiating the surface of the screen with radiations 5 having strong energy and capable of being focused in the form of a spot or line, such as laser beams, or ultrasonic waves, the irradiation device is moved according to a pattern previously inputted into a computer to sequentially melt the film at the irradiation point, thereby obtaining a screen stencil for textile printing which has a pattern 6.
